Visit the authentic site of a Tonkawa Indian encampment in the early 1800s, long before Texas was a state, and learn about how the First Texans lived, worked and played, and about how they interacted with the early white settlers.

Nature and natural resource conservation are key components. This is a hands-on history class that will take your students back to the days of the Republic of Texas. Reservations are required. Guided tours are available. Available on Thursdays only from January to August, and from September to early December.

  Fee is $5 per student. Duration is 4 hours, 10 a.m. to 2 p.m.
